- Title
Weight bearing protocol for surgical and non-surgical musculoskeletal disorders of the lower limbs.
- Authors
Irsay, László; Cotocel, Andreea; Neacşu, Anda; Năstase, Ioana; Ungur, Rodica; Borda, Ileana Monica; Ciortea, Viorela; Onac, Ioan
- Abstract
Admission of patients from the Orthopedic Surgery Department into the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ation departments is very frequent. Depending on the case, immobilization is followed by a gradual increase in the weight placed on the lower limbs. The weight bearing rhythm and the recommended walking aids must be selected on an individualized basis, depending on the primary orthopedic problem as well as a number of other factors: the patient's muscle strength in the upper and lower limbs, their ability to maintain their static and dynamic balance, the integrity of their auditory, visual and proprioception systems and any associated cardiovascular, metabolic and respiratory disorders. The protocol below helps the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ation physician to establish the weight bearing rhythm for the lower limbs. It must be noted that the weight bearing program is selected on a strictly individualized basis and that there is no universally applicable protocol.
